Explore a Variety of Online Platforms Tailored for Germany Users
The German online dating landscape offers numerous platforms catering to different demographics and relationship goals. Each platform has distinct features designed to serve specific needs within the German market. International services like Tinder, Bumble, and OkCupid have strong presences in Germany but operate alongside local favorites such as Parship, ElitePartner, and eDarling.
Local platforms often incorporate cultural nuances specific to German dating customs and social expectations. For example, some emphasize detailed personality assessments reflecting German appreciation for thoroughness, while others focus on facilitating in-person meetings at local events throughout German cities. Additionally, niche platforms serve specific communities, including those for various age groups, professionals in particular industries, or people seeking specific types of relationships.

Common Online Dating Platforms in Germany
Several dating platforms have established significant user bases in the German market, each with unique approaches to fostering connections.
| Platform | Primary Focus | Key Features | Approximate Monthly Cost |
|---|---|---|---|
| Parship | Long-term relationships | Scientific matching algorithm, detailed personality assessment | €39-69 |
| ElitePartner | Academic/professional singles | Education verification, high-quality profiles | €49-69 |
| eDarling | Serious relationships across age groups | Comprehensive compatibility testing | €24-59 |
| LoveScout24 | Diverse dating options | Large user base, robust search filters | €20-40 |
| Finya | Budget-friendly dating | Completely free service, ad-supported | €0 |
| Lovoo | Casual and serious dating | Live radar function showing nearby users | €0-24 |

Navigating Cultural Aspects of Online Dating in Germany
Success on German dating platforms often requires understanding certain cultural nuances. Germans typically value directness and authenticity in their communications—a trait that extends to online dating. Profiles that clearly state intentions and honestly represent personality traits tend to receive more positive responses than those perceived as overly calculated or insincere.
The pace of relationship development may differ from other countries. German dating culture often involves taking time to establish connections before meeting in person, with substantive conversations preceding physical meetings. Many successful users report that patience and genuine interest in getting to know someone intellectually creates stronger foundations for relationships that begin online. This approach aligns well with the structured nature of many German dating platforms, which guide users through progressive stages of communication.
